1. RK3588芯片架构解析
RK3588作为瑞芯微旗舰级应用处理器,其架构设计充分考虑了高性能计算与低功耗需求的平衡。芯片采用8核big.LITTLE架构,包含4个Cortex-A76大核(主频可达2.4GHz)和4个Cortex-A55小核(主频1.8GHz),通过动态调频技术实现能效优化。在实际工程应用中,这种架构特别适合需要突发高性能又兼顾长时间续航的场景,比如智能NVR、工业控制设备等。
注意:A76大核与A55小核共享L3缓存,在任务调度时需要特别注意缓存一致性设计。
多媒体子系统是RK3588的突出亮点:
- 视频编解码器支持8K@30fps H.265/H.264解码和8K@15fps编码
- 独立JPEG编解码器可实现8000万像素/秒的处理能力
- 三路ISP支持最高4800万像素摄像头输入
- 四显示输出接口(2xHDMI2.1、DP1.4、MIPI-DSI)
在AI加速方面,内置NPU支持INT4/INT8/INT16/FP16混合精度运算,实测ResNet50推理速度可达800fps以上。特别值得注意的是其TensorFlow Lite兼容性,使得现有AI模型可以快速迁移部署。
2. 最小系统设计关键要点
2.1 时钟系统设计规范
24MHz主时钟电路设计要点:
- 晶体选型必须满足:
- 负载电容CL=8pF(典型值)
- 等效串联电阻ESR≤80Ω
- 频率稳定度±20ppm
- 外围电路设计:
- 限流电阻R1=22Ω(不可省略)
- 反馈电阻R2=510KΩ(精度1%)
- 负载电容C1=C2=6pF(COG材质)
32.768KHz待机时钟设计注意事项:
- 外部晶体需满足:
- 负载电容12.5pF
- 驱动电平≤1μW
- 老化率±3ppm/年
- 布局时需远离高频信号线
- 建议在PCB背面增加接地屏蔽环
2.2 复位电路设计要点
硬件复位设计必须满足:
- 复位脉冲宽度≥4μs
- 上升时间≤1μs
- 去耦电容100nF(X7R材质)
- 走线长度控制在20mm以内
双PMIC方案的特殊要求:
- RK806-1负责VDD_LOGIC供电
- RK806-2管理DDR电源
- 两个PMIC的RESETB信号需同步
- 上电时序误差需<100μs
2.3 存储子系统设计
2.3.1 LPDDR4/5接口设计
布线关键参数:
- 单端阻抗40Ω±10%
- 差分阻抗80Ω±10%
- 长度匹配±50mil
- 最大走线长度≤2.5英寸
电源设计要求:
| 电源网络 | 电压 | 纹波要求 | 去耦电容 |
|---|---|---|---|
| VDD1 | 1.8V | ≤50mV | 10μF+0.1μF |
| VDDQ | 1.1V | ≤30mV | 22μF+1μF |
| VDD2 | 1.2V | ≤50mV | 4.7μF+0.1μF |
2.3.2 eMMC接口设计
HS400模式布线要点:
- CLK信号串联0Ω电阻
- DATA_Strobe长度匹配±100ps
- 数据线组内偏差≤25ps
- 建议采用6层板设计
上电时序要求:
- VCC(3.3V)先上电
- 延迟10ms后VCCQ(1.8V)上电
- 再延迟5ms释放复位
3. PCB布局实战技巧
3.1 电源系统布局
多层板叠层建议:
- Top层:信号+少量元件
- 内层1:完整地平面
- 内层2:电源分割
- 内层3:信号布线
- 底层:器件+电源
电源分割原则:
- DDR电源区域≥25mm²
- 核心电源区域≥30mm²
- 各电源域间距≥3mm
- 关键电源采用铜块加强散热
3.2 高速信号布线
差分对布线规范:
- 保持100Ω差分阻抗
- 线间距≥3倍线宽
- 避免90°拐角
- 过孔数量≤3个/英寸
时钟信号特殊处理:
- 包地处理(上下左右全包围)
- 禁止跨越电源分割
- 远离I/O接口≥5mm
- 长度匹配±50ps
4. 调试与问题排查
常见启动问题排查流程:
- 测量24MHz时钟幅度(应≥0.8Vpp)
- 检查复位信号波形
- 确认PMIC输出电压精度
- 检测DDR训练结果
- 查看UART调试信息
典型DDR问题解决方案:
- 读写错误:检查VDDQ电压精度
- 训练失败:调整ODT参数
- 高频不稳定:优化去耦电容布局
- 低温异常:检查时序参数余量
实际项目中的经验教训:
- 某项目因晶体负载电容偏差导致启动失败
- DDR4布线过孔过多引起信号完整性问题
- 电源时序错误导致eMMC识别异常
- 散热设计不足引发高温降频
5. 设计验证要点
必须进行的测试项目:
- 电源完整性测试(PDN阻抗≤100mΩ)
- 信号完整性测试(眼图测试)
- 时序验证(建立/保持时间余量)
- 热成像测试(结温≤85℃)
- EMC测试(辐射发射达标)
建议的测试设备:
- 示波器(带宽≥1GHz)
- 逻辑分析仪(采样率≥4GS/s)
- 网络分析仪(VNA)
- 热像仪(分辨率≥320×240)
在完成首版设计后,建议先用评估板验证关键子系统功能,再着手自主设计。对于时钟、DDR等敏感电路,务必进行阻抗测试和信号完整性仿真。